Atgriež izteiksmi, kas formatēta kā datums vai laiks.
Sintakse
FormatDateTime(Datums [, NamedFormat ] )
Funkcijas FormatDateTime sintaksei ir šādi argumenti:
| Arguments | Apraksts |
|---|---|
| Datums | Obligāts arguments. Formatējamā datuma izteiksme. |
| Nosaukuma formāts | Neobligāts arguments. Skaitliska vērtība, kas norāda izmantoto datuma/laika formātu. Ja tas tiek izlaists, tiek izmantots vbGeneralDate . |
Iestatījumi
Argumentam NamedFormat ir šādi iestatījumi.
| Konstante | Vērtība | Apraksts |
|---|---|---|
| vbGeneralDate | 0 | Datuma un/vai laika parādīšana. Ja tajā ir datuma daļa, parādīt to kā īsu datuma apzīmējumu. Ja ir laika daļa, parādīt to kā garo laika periodu. Ja tādas ir, tiek parādītas abas daļas. |
| vbLongDate | 1 | Parāda datumu, izmantojot garo datuma formātu, kas norādīts datora reģionālajos iestatījumos. |
| vbShortDate | 2 | Parāda datumu, izmantojot īso datuma formātu, kas norādīts datora reģionālajos iestatījumos. |
| vbLongTime | 3 | Parāda laiku, izmantojot laika formātu, kas norādīts datora reģionālajos iestatījumos. |
| vbShortTime | 4 | Parāda laiku, izmantojot 24 stundu formātu (hh:mm). |
Piemēri
| Izteiksme | Rezultāti |
|---|---|
| SELECT FormatDateTime([DateTime],0) AS Expr1 FROM ProductSales; | Formatē un parāda datuma vērtības laukā "Datums/vai laiks". |
| SELECT FormatDateTime([DateTime],1) AS NewDate FROM ProductSales; | Formatē un parāda datuma vērtības laukā "DateTime" kā garā datuma formātu. Formatē un parāda datuma vērtības laukā "DatumsLaiks" kā īso datuma formātu. |
| SELECT FormatDateTime([DateTime],3) AS NewDate FROM ProductSales; | Formatē un parāda datuma vērtības laukā "DatumsLaiks" formātā (bez datuma). |
| SELECT FormatDateTime([DateTime],4) AS NewDate FROM ProductSales; | Formatē un parāda datuma vērtības laukā "Datums/laiks" kā 24 stundu "Laiks" formātu (bez datuma). |